Mangaluru, Aug 21: Fr Albert Gregory Menezes, a senior priest of the diocese of Mangalore, passed away on August 21, at the age of 94 at St Zuze Vaz Home, Jeppu.
Born on December 23, 1932, Fr Menezes hailed from Agrar and was the son of P Jacob Menezes and Mercine D'Souza.
He was ordained a priest on December 5, 1959, and dedicated nearly seven decades to priestly ministry, pastoral service and the spiritual welfare of the faithful across the diocese of Mangalore.

During his long ministry, Fr Menezes served in several parishes in different capacities. He began his pastoral service as assistant parish priest at St Lawrence Church, Karkala, in 1960. He subsequently served as vicar/assistant at Belle in 1962, Udyavar in 1963, Kirem in 1965 and Bejai in 1966.
He later served as parish priest at Nellikar from 1969, Vittal from 1976, Ajekar from 1983, Hosabettu from 1985, Kanajar from 1986, Gangoli from 1993, Petri from 1995, Bolkunje from 1997 and Kalathur from 2000.
He also served as chaplain at Mary Hill in 1992 and as parish administrator in Mukka in 1999.
In 2008, Fr Menezes retired to the Senior Priests' Home at St Antony's Institute. He later moved to St Zuze Vaz Home, Jeppu, where he spent his final years.
